Facebook: The First Ten Years

By: Shane Greenstein, Marco Iansiti and Christine Snively
  • Format:Print
  • | Language:English
  • | Pages:15 
ShareBar

Abstract

Facebook celebrated its ten year anniversary in February 2014. Over the past decade it has grown into the largest social network in the world with one billion users. After filing an IPO in 2012 at a $104 billion valuation (the third largest IPO in U.S. history), the stock price steadily declined, but recovered after the company implemented an effective advertising strategy. Facebook worked to maintain its "hacker ethos" and remain nimble as it matured. The company was worth close to $200 billion. Could this kind of value sustain itself for years to come?
